From Fortune: "A sharp selloff in tech stocks on Thursday underscored investors' exhaustion with the "spend now, profit later" model that has propelled the AI bull market for three years. Microsoft led the retreat, with its shares plummeting 12% by noon, erasing more than $440 billion in market value, a collapse it hasn't seen since the pandemic. The Nasdaq was down almost 2% at time of writing."

From Fortune: "A sharp selloff in tech stocks on Thursday underscored investors' exhaustion with the "spend now, profit later" model that has propelled the AI bull market for three years. Microsoft led the retreat, with its shares plummeting 12% by noon, erasing more than $440 billion in market value, a collapse it hasn't seen since the pandemic. The Nasdaq was down almost 2% at time of writing."

Also from Fortune: "The sentiment shift is not limited to Redmond. Oracle has seen its shares halved from their September highs, erasing nearly $463 billion in value. Once a darling of the AI trade, Oracle has also struggled with investor confidence that the massive data centers it is building for OpenAI will get funded eventually. Additionally, the timeline for several projects has reportedly slipped to 2028, creating a gap between the company's heavy debt-funded spending and the arrival of actual revenue.

OpenAI has made about $1.4 trillion in commitments to procure both the energy and compute it needs to fuel its operations. But its revenue barely crossed $20 billion in 2025."

Letter to the Guardian.
The protection of badgers has a long pedigree (Report, 29 August). Arthur Gore, known as "Boofy", the eighth Earl of Arran, was a fanatical defender of them. He was also a tireless campaigner for the rights of homosexuals. In 1967 he managed to push through a law in the Lords that decriminalised homosexuality but failed to pass a bill to outlaw the cruel hunting of badgers. When asked why he had not received enough support for his badger bill, he replied: "Not many badgers in the House of Lords." Tony Lywood Keswick, Cumbria

I Want You to Understand Chicago
Politics Chicago
2025-11-08

I want you to understand what it is like to live in Chicago during this time.

Every day my phone buzzes. It is a neighborhood group: four people were kidnapped at the corner drugstore. A friend a mile away sends a Slack message: she was at the scene when masked men assaulted and abducted two people on the street. A plumber working on my pipes is distraught, and I find out that two of his employees were kidnapped that morning. A week later it happens again.

An email arrives. Agents with guns have chased a teacher into the school where she works. They did not have a warrant. They dragged her away, ignoring her and her colleagues’ pleas to show proof of her documentation. That evening I stand a few feet from the parents of Rayito de Sol and listen to them describe, with anguish, how good Ms. Diana was to their children. What it is like to have strangers with guns traumatize your kids. For a teacher to hide a three-year-old child for fear they might be killed. How their relatives will no longer leave the house. I hear the pain and fury in their voices, and I wonder who will be next.

Understand what it is to pray in Chicago. On September 19th, Reverend David Black, lead pastor at First Presbyterian Church of Chicago, was praying outside the ICE detention center in Broadview when a DHS agent shot him in the head with pepper balls. Pepper balls are never supposed to be fired at the head because they can seriously injure, or even kill. β€œWe could hear them laughing as they were shooting us from the roof,” Black recalled. He is not the only member of the clergy ICE has assaulted. Methodist pastor Hannah Kardon was violently arrested on October 17th, and Baptist pastor Michael Woolf was shot with pepper balls on November 1st.
